#17e4a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17e4a2 is composed of 9% red, 89.4%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.9%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 160.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 49.2%. #17e4a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#00c945.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#17e4a2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17e4a2 has RGB values of R:23, G:228,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1565858.

Shades and Tints of #17e4a2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e0a is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#17e4a2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788380 is the less saturated color, while #04f7a9 is the most saturated one.
